Chelsea owner Roman Abramovich released a statement on Wednesday evening revealing he will sell the club. Having bought the Blues back in 2003, Abramovich has helped Chelsea become one of the most feared sides in Europe.
With news that a new owner could soon be about to take over, City fans took to social media to have their say on the breaking news, and it's clear they're not too worried about what the future could hold for the London club.

City meet Manchester United this weekend in the Manchester derby. Before Sunday's fixture, there will be a "moment of reflection and solidarity" at the Etihad and all other stadiums hosting Premier League clashes.
“A show of solidarity for Ukraine will be visible at all Premier League matches from Saturday 5 to Monday 7 March. This follows the numerous ways in which clubs have already demonstrated their support," the Premier League said in a statement on Wednesday.
